-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
Showing
2 changed files
with
42 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,24 @@ | ||
--- | ||
title: PowerShell aliasok létrehozása | ||
feed: show | ||
slug: powershell-aliasok-letrehozasa | ||
date: 30-07-2024 | ||
--- | ||
|
||
Először is, le kell kérni a default profil elérését, amire a legtutibb megoldás, ha futtatjuk a következőt: | ||
|
||
```powershell | ||
echo $PROFILE | ||
``` | ||
|
||
Ennek eredményeképpen megkapjuk a default profil elérését, a továbbiakban ezt fogjuk használni. | ||
|
||
Az adott fájlban tudjuk felvenni az aliasokat: | ||
|
||
```powershell | ||
function Go-Repo {Set-Location $env:USERPROFILE'\Developer'} | ||
Set-Alias -Name repo -Value Go-Repo | ||
function Ip-Address {curl https://checkip.amazonaws.com/} | ||
Set-Alias -Name whatismyip -Value Ip-Address | ||
```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,18 @@ | ||
--- | ||
title: SpringBoot Scheduler kiütése | ||
slug: spring-scheduler-kiutese | ||
feed: show | ||
date: 30-07-2024 | ||
--- | ||
|
||
SpringBoot alkalmazásoknál előfordulhat, hogy egy adott `@Scheduled` annotációval ellátott folyamatnál nem szeretnénk, hogy bármikor fusson. Ennek megoldására több lehetőség is van, az egyik a `@ConditionalOnProperty` annotáció használata, a másik pedig a `@Scheduled` annotáció `cron` paraméterének használata. | ||
|
||
Utóbbi (és vszg. legegyszerűbb megoldás), ha a cron paraméterrel kapcsoljuk ki a futást. | ||
`application.yml`-ben pl.: | ||
```yaml | ||
app: | ||
my-scheduler: | ||
cron: '-' | ||
``` | ||
A `-` érték segítségével a cron paramétert ki tudjuk kapcsolni, így a folyamat nem fog lefutni. |